In conjunction with the DMA’s exhibition Impressionist Paintings from the Reves Collection, join Dr. Anthea Callen, an internationally renowned specialist on the history of artists’ materials and techniques, for a lecture on the origins, novelty, and meanings of the impressionist painters’ methods. She will discuss the plein air oil painting techniques of landscapists and their impact on figure painting, studio practice, and display.
